Integrating CBT and Client-Centered Care for Online Support

Patricia frequently uses cognitive behavioral therapy to help clients identify and shift unhelpful thought patterns and develop practical skills for managing symptoms like anxiety, depression, and panic. She also draws on client-centered therapy, which emphasizes empathy, respect, and tailoring conversations to each person's values and goals, making space for clients to lead discussions about what matters most to them.

Choosing the right therapeutic approach is a collaborative process. Patricia works with clients to evaluate which methods align with their needs and preferences, combining techniques when helpful and adjusting the plan as progress and goals evolve. This partnership helps ensure the work stays relevant and focused on real-life concerns.

Online therapy options include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ging, allowing for flexibility in how and when people engage in treatment. These formats make it easier to fit sessions into busy schedules and support consistent contact between appointments, while still allowing licensed professionals to use structured methods like CBT, mindfulness, and DBT skills to address emotional regulation, coping, and personal growth.
